CVE-2026-22489 MEDIUM

CVE-2026-22489: WordPress Image Slider Slideshow plugin <= 1.8 - Insecure Direct Object References (IDOR) vulnerability

Vendor Wptexture
Product Image Slider Slideshow
Weakness CWE-639 · IDOR
Published January 8, 2026
Last update April 28, 2026

CVSS base score

4.3/10
Attack vector Network
Attack complexity Low
Privileges required Low
User interaction None
Confidentiality None
Integrity Low

CVSS vector

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N

What the vulnerability does

01Description

Authorization Bypass Through User-Controlled Key vulnerability in Wptexture Image Slider Slideshow image-slider-slideshow allows Exploiting Incorrectly Configured Access Control Security Levels.This issue affects Image Slider Slideshow: from n/a through <= 1.8.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ms

02Summary

The Image Slider Slideshow plugin for WordPress contains an authorization flaw that allows authenticated users with low privileges to modify content they should not have access to. The vulnerability affects versions up to 1.8 and requires a valid user account to exploit. Site administrators should update to a version newer than 1.8 to mitigate this risk.

What an attacker can do

03Attacker Capabilities

Modify or alter slider content without proper authorization.

Potential impact on your site

04Site Impact

Unauthorized users can alter slider images or settings, potentially defacing or disrupting site content.

Conditions required to exploit

05Prerequisites

Attacker must have a valid low-privilege user account on the site.
